A woman from Harbour Breton is “Set for Life” after she scratched a lottery ticket in late March.
Doris Baker says she usually scratches half and leaves the other half for her husband but it was late at night and she wanted to get it over with.
Baker opted for the lump-sum payment of $675,000 rather than the $1,000 a week for 25 years for her win on the Atlantic Lottery’s Set for Life Scratch’ N Win ticket.
She says their family has already picked out a new truck and they plan to bring two of their children home to Newfoundland for a family celebration.
